E-Tablolar makrosu manifest kaynağı

E-Tablolar makrolarını tanımlamak için kullanılan yapılandırma. Makroları tanımlayan manifestler, Zorunlu olarak işaretlenen tüm alanları içermelidir.

E-Tablolar

E-Tablolar makro manifest yapılandırmasının en üst düzeyi. Bu yalnızca E-Tablolar makrolarını tanımlamak için kullanılır.

JSON gösterimi
{
  "macros": [
    {
      object (Macro)
    }
  ]
}
Alanlar
macros[]

object (Macro)

Zorunludur. Tanımlanmış makroların ve bunlarla ilişkili özelliklerin listesi.

Makro

Tek bir makronun yapılandırması. Tanımlarda Zorunlu olarak işaretlenen tüm alanlar yer almalıdır.

JSON gösterimi
{
  "defaultShortcut": string,
  "functionName": string,
  "menuName": string
}
Alanlar
defaultShortcut

string

Makroyu yürüten klavye kısayolu. Şu biçimde olmalıdır: Ctrl+Alt+Shift+*Number*. Kısayolu olmayan makrolar yalnızca **Araçlar** > **Makrolar** menüsünden çalıştırılabilir.
functionName

string

Zorunludur. Makroyu yürüten Apps Komut Dosyası işlevinin adı. Bu, varsayılan olarak otomatik oluşturulan işlevler için menuName ile eşleşir ancak bu bir zorunluluk değildir.
menuName

string

Zorunludur. Makronun Google E-Tablolar kullanıcı arayüzünde gösterilen adı.